The application discloses an easy-to-adjust drainage pipe installation frame, which relates to the technical field of drainage pipe installation, and includes a bracket. A fixed ring plate is arranged on both sides of one end of the bracket, and a turning ring plate is installed on one side of the fixed ring plate. , the inner walls of the turning ring plate and the fixed ring plate are respectively provided with soft boards, a moving structure is arranged between the fixed ring plate and the bracket, a mounting plate is provided at the end of the bracket away from the turning ring plate, and the installation plate and the bracket There is an angle adjustment structure between them. This application is provided with a chute, a screw hole 1, a stud 1 and a connection plate, and the turning ring plate is assembled by sliding through the chute between the connection plate and the bracket. The chute is for the connection plate to slide left and right, and the screw hole 1 is provided with multiple , the connection plate is positioned and installed between the bracket through the screw hole 1 under the action of the stud 1, and the drainpipe installation frame can adjust the position of the fixed ring plate as required.

本申请公开一种便于调节的排水管安装架。参照图1,一种便于调节的排水管安装架,包括支架1,支架1一端的两侧均设置有固定环板3,且固定环板3的一侧转动有翻环板2,翻环板2和固定环板3的内壁分别设置有软板6,固定环板3和支架1之间设置有移动结构4,移动结构4包括连接盘404,支架1的中间位置处开设有呈条形的滑槽401,连接盘404滑动安装于支架1内部且处于滑槽401内,连接盘404沿滑槽401能够进行左右滑动。连接盘404远离支架1的一侧与固定环板3固定连接,支架1外壁且处于滑槽401的上下两端均开设有螺孔一402,其中,螺孔一402在支架1表面处于滑槽401的上下呈等间距分别有多个,能够将连接盘404调节固定在合适位置处,连接盘404靠近软板6一端的顶端和底端均螺纹安装有螺柱一403,且螺柱一403插入螺孔一402内,螺孔一402和螺柱一403为螺纹连接。The application discloses a drainpipe installation frame that is convenient for adjustment. With reference to Fig. 1, a kind of easy-to-adjust drainpipe installation frame comprises bracket 1, and both sides of one end of bracket 1 are all provided with fixed ring plate 3, and one side of fixed ring plate 3 rotates to have turning ring plate 2, turning ring plate 2 and the inner wall of the fixed ring plate 3 are respectively provided with a soft plate 6, and a moving structure 4 is arranged between the fixed ring plate 3 and the bracket 1. The moving structure 4 includes a connection plate 404, and a bar-shaped The chute 401 and the connection plate 404 are slidably installed inside the bracket 1 and located in the chute 401 , the connection plate 404 can slide left and right along the chute 401 . The side of the connection plate 404 away from the support 1 is fixedly connected to the fixed ring plate 3, and the outer wall of the support 1 and the upper and lower ends of the chute 401 are provided with a screw hole 402, wherein the screw hole 1 402 is located in the chute on the surface of the support 1 There are a plurality of 401 at equal intervals up and down, respectively, and the connection plate 404 can be adjusted and fixed at a suitable position. The top and bottom ends of the connection plate 404 near the end of the soft board 6 are threaded with a stud one 403, and the stud one 403 Insert into screw hole 1 402, screw hole 1 402 and stud 1 403 are threaded connections.

参照图1,使用时首先根据需要判断是否需要调节固定环板3所处位置,调节时,拆卸螺柱一403,解除连接盘404与支架1之间的关系,将连接盘404根据需要沿滑槽401滑动至合适位置,再次通过螺柱一403和螺孔一402的配合下对连接盘404和支架1之间固定。Referring to Fig. 1, when using, first judge whether the position of the fixed ring plate 3 needs to be adjusted according to the needs. When adjusting, remove the stud 1 403, release the relationship between the connecting plate 404 and the bracket 1, and slide the connecting plate 404 along the The groove 401 is slid to a proper position, and the connecting plate 404 and the bracket 1 are fixed again through cooperation of the first stud 403 and the first screw hole 402 .

参照图1-3,翻环板2和固定环板3远离连接处设置有组装结构5;组装结构5包括连接架501,连接架501转动安装于翻环板2远离与固定环板3连接处的一端,连接架501远离于翻环板2连接处的一端螺纹贯穿设置有螺销504,且螺销504的外壁固定有挡片503,避免螺销504与连接架501之间脱离。固定环板3远离与翻环板2连接处一端的外壁开设有挤压孔502,挡片503卡接在挤压孔502内,且螺销504与挤压孔502螺纹连接,翻环板2和固定环板3之间进行固定。Referring to Figures 1-3, an assembly structure 5 is provided away from the connection between the turning ring plate 2 and the fixed ring plate 3; One end of the connecting frame 501 away from the connection of the turning ring plate 2 is threaded with a screw pin 504, and the outer wall of the screw pin 504 is fixed with a stopper 503 to prevent the screw pin 504 from being separated from the connecting frame 501. An extrusion hole 502 is provided on the outer wall of the fixed ring plate 3 away from the connection with the turning ring plate 2, and the retaining piece 503 is snapped into the extrusion hole 502, and the screw pin 504 is threadedly connected with the extrusion hole 502, and the turning ring plate 2 It is fixed with the fixed ring plate 3.

参照图3,排水管安装后,连接架501翻转,对翻环板2和固定环板3之间进行组装,挡片503和挤压孔502对应后,旋转螺销504,螺销504延伸至挤压孔502内,挡片503对挤压孔502挤压,固定环板3和翻环板2进行固定。Referring to Fig. 3, after the drainpipe is installed, the connecting frame 501 is turned over, and the turning ring plate 2 and the fixed ring plate 3 are assembled, and after the blocking plate 503 corresponds to the extrusion hole 502, the screw pin 504 is rotated, and the screw pin 504 extends to In the extrusion hole 502, the blocking piece 503 squeezes the extrusion hole 502, and the fixed ring plate 3 and the turning ring plate 2 are fixed.

参照图2和图4,支架1远离翻环板2的一端设置有安装板7,且安装板7和支架1之间设置有角度调节结构8;角度调节结构8包括连接块804以及连接柱806,连接块804固定于安装板7靠近支架1一侧的中间位置处,连接柱806安装于支架1靠近安装板7一端的中间位置处,且连接柱806一端插入连接块804内,连接柱806和连接块804之间为转动连接。连接柱806处于连接块804内部的外壁上以连接柱806中心线为圆心呈环形等间距分布开设有螺孔二803,能够对支架1进行任何角度调节。Referring to Fig. 2 and Fig. 4, a mounting plate 7 is provided on the end of the bracket 1 away from the turning ring plate 2, and an angle adjustment structure 8 is provided between the installation plate 7 and the bracket 1; the angle adjustment structure 8 includes a connecting block 804 and a connecting column 806 , the connecting block 804 is fixed on the middle position of the side of the mounting plate 7 close to the bracket 1, the connecting column 806 is installed on the middle position of the end of the bracket 1 close to the mounting plate 7, and one end of the connecting column 806 is inserted into the connecting block 804, and the connecting column 806 It is rotationally connected with the connecting block 804. On the outer wall of the connecting column 806 inside the connecting block 804, screw holes 2 803 are arranged at equal intervals in a ring with the center line of the connecting column 806 as the center, so that the bracket 1 can be adjusted at any angle.

另外,连接块804的外壁螺纹安装有螺柱二801,且螺柱二801插入螺孔二803内,并且螺柱二801和连接柱806通过螺孔二803螺纹连接。安装板7一端且处于连接块804外壁开设有导槽805,导槽呈环状,支架1一端处于连接柱806两侧均固定有导杆802,且导杆802远离支架1的一端位于导槽805内,导杆802和安装板7之间通过导槽805为滑动连接,提高支架1旋转时与安装板7之间的稳定性。In addition, the outer wall of the connecting block 804 is threaded with a second stud 801 , and the second stud 801 is inserted into the second screw hole 803 , and the second stud 801 and the connecting column 806 are threadedly connected through the second screw hole 803 . One end of the mounting plate 7 and the outer wall of the connecting block 804 are provided with a guide groove 805, the guide groove is annular, one end of the support 1 is fixed on both sides of the connecting column 806 with guide rods 802, and the end of the guide rod 802 away from the support 1 is located in the guide groove In 805, the guide rod 802 and the mounting plate 7 are slidingly connected through the guide groove 805, which improves the stability between the bracket 1 and the mounting plate 7 when it rotates.

参照图2和图4,使用前,判断是否需要调节支架1的倾斜角度,调节时,旋转取出螺柱二801,解除连接块804和连接柱806关系,将支架1旋转,旋转过程中,导杆802沿导杆802滑动,随后旋转插入螺柱二801,对连接块804和连接柱806进行固定。Referring to Figure 2 and Figure 4, before use, judge whether it is necessary to adjust the inclination angle of the bracket 1. When adjusting, rotate and take out the second stud 801, release the relationship between the connecting block 804 and the connecting column 806, and rotate the bracket 1. During the rotation, guide The rod 802 slides along the guide rod 802 , and then is rotated and inserted into the second stud 801 to fix the connecting block 804 and the connecting post 806 .

本申请的一种便于调节的排水管安装架的实施原理为:The implementation principle of a conveniently adjustable drainage pipe installation frame of the present application is as follows:

首先将安装板7安装在排水管所安装的物体上方,根据需要调节支架1的倾斜度,调节时,旋转卸除螺柱二801,支架1带动连接柱806进行旋转,随后旋转插入螺柱二801,螺柱二801旋转进入螺孔二803内,对连接块804和连接柱806之间进行固定。First install the mounting plate 7 above the object installed by the drain pipe, adjust the inclination of the bracket 1 according to the needs, when adjusting, rotate and remove the stud 2 801, the bracket 1 drives the connecting column 806 to rotate, and then rotate and insert the stud 2 801 , the second stud 801 is rotated into the second screw hole 803 to fix the connecting block 804 and the connecting column 806 .

其次根据需要判断是否调节排水管所处位置,调节时,旋转取出螺柱一403,将固定环板3根据需要沿滑槽401滑动,再通过螺柱一403对连接盘404和支架1之间通过螺孔一402安装固定。Secondly, judge whether to adjust the position of the drain pipe according to the needs. When adjusting, rotate and take out the stud 403, slide the fixed ring plate 3 along the chute 401 as required, and then pass the stud 403 between the connection plate 404 and the bracket 1. Install and fix through screw hole one 402.

最后将排水管摆放在固定环板3和翻环板2之间,翻环板2旋转,软板6接触排水管,对排水管起到夹持固定作用,连接架501翻转,螺销504旋转,螺销504旋转插入挤压孔502中,对固定环板3和翻环板2之间进行固定,最终完成该排水管的安装工作。Finally, the drain pipe is placed between the fixed ring plate 3 and the ring turning plate 2, the ring turning plate 2 rotates, the soft plate 6 touches the drain pipe, and plays a role of clamping and fixing the drain pipe. The connecting frame 501 is turned over, and the screw pin 504 Rotate, the screw pin 504 is rotated and inserted into the extrusion hole 502 to fix between the fixed ring plate 3 and the turning ring plate 2, and finally complete the installation of the drain pipe.
